Fred Ball is a Grammy-nominated, multi-platinum selling record producer and songwriter living in London. Originally from Norway, Fred moved to the UK when he formed his project Pleasure. The critically acclaimed debut album was hailed as The Sunday Times’ favourite debut of the year. The success of Pleasure helped launch the start of Fred’s songwriting and production career. He was approached to write and produce for a wide selection of artists. His production and writing credits include Rihanna, Zara Larsson, Little Mix, Kylie Minogue, Madonna, KT Tunstall, Brett Anderson, JLS, Petite Meller, Arrow Benjamin, Jessie Ware, Prince Charlez, Madison Beer, Anne Marie, Toni Braxton, JP Cooper, Bernhoft and more. In 2015, he was nominated for the “Best R&B album” Grammy for Bernhoft’s Islander. He co-wrote and produced “Love On The Brain” for Rihanna’s latest album ANTI.
